Right-wing author: ‘Insane’ gay rights are driving people to suicide

Right-wing author: ‘Insane’ gay rights are driving people to suicide

David Kupelian is the managing editor of feverishly right-wing website WorldNetDaily, and he’s just writing a book zippily titled “The Snapping of the American Mind.”

Discussing his work with Gun Owners of America’s Larry Pratt on “Gun Owners News Hour” — ?! — Kupelian opined that liberalism is driving Americans to suicide, addiction, and depression.

The overarching theme of his book is that the “progressive Left” “whether intentionally or not” promotes “widespread dependency, debauchery, family breakdown, crime, corruption, addiction, despair, and suicide.”

Examples he cites of “completely insane” liberalism run amok: “the sexual revolution and the LGBT movement,” the fact that there are 50 genders to choose from on Facebook,“forcing teenage girls to have to shower with boys,” and marriage equality. Naturally.

He tells Pratt, “These are things that most people, and a few years ago everybody, would have said is not only wrong but is completely insane, okay? A few years ago, we would have said two men getting married is completely insane. Everybody in the world of all religions, left, right, center, everybody would have said you’re completely insane.”

The case that I’m making in ‘The Snapping of the American Mind’ is that you know how we hear about all the suicides going on now, we hear about the huge upsurge among white, middle-class people living in the suburbs, we hear about the huge amount, one in four middle-aged women are taking antidepressants, we have all this individual pathology, all this wretchedness, all the suffering of the addiction and the 110 million people with sexually transmitted diseases. 110 million! All of these things, I’m saying that the left is the primary cause of all of this depression, anxiety, the huge amount of mental illness, of addiction, of suicide, all of these things that we hear about in a way that we sometimes hear about them in the news, but disconnect them from the source.”
